My question is: Was Annie Oakley actually born in Darke County, Ohio or was she born in Terre Haute, Indiana as I previously led to believe? I used to stay with my Great Aunt and Uncle in the home in which Annie was raised, on Rt. 127 close to North Star, Ohio. There is still a stone Monument there at the site where the house stood before it was moved to Terre Haute to be put in a museum. I understood the reason for moving it was to take it to the location where she was born.

Can you please clear this up for me? -- -- -- Thank you!
